Okay, this one has been haunting me for a while now. I used to have black apache helicopter which transformed into a robot. The head was silver, the arms transformed from out of the missile pods on the "wings", and the legs came out from under the helicopter. A large bulk of it was die-cast metal. All in all, it was a pretty cool figure, so much so, I remember using this figure as a Decepticon (even though it wasn't a Transformer), and I thought for the longest time it was a Gobot. tfu.info is an invaluable resource but I noticed a couple of things in that link. Firstly it says there are no known variations but I have a green one so there must be at least two versions. Secondly the robot mode picture has the blades on the chest which looks stupid. That hole goes right through the body so the blades can be attached to the back in robot mode, which looks ten times better and allows the arms free movement.
